  • NV Yalumba Muscat Antique Muscat

    Australia, South Australia

    The wine shows tawny amber colour
    In the nose, the wine shows raisin notes, dried fruit notes, dates and figs, varnish notes, rose petal liqueur. Palate follows the style, very sweet texture, grapey, warmth, grape jam, stone fruit jam, raisin notes, dark fruit, honey and syrup, low acidity, layered, long finish
    Called it Rutherglen

  • NV Sánchez Romate Hnos. Pedro Ximénez Jerez-Xérès-Sherry

    Spain, Andalucía, Jerez-Xérès-Sherry

    The wine shows murky brown colour
    In the nose, the wine shows very sweet profile, rose petal liqueur, dark honey notes, heavy syrup, dates and figs, olive notes, sweet spices notes, oak notes. Give you a dark lager wort nuance too
    Palate follows the pattern, raisin, figs, plums, again the “wort” but more upfront, thick oak frame, again olive notes, viscous, thick, cloying, long finish
    Called this PX

  • NV Henriques & Henriques Madeira Malvazia 10 Years Old

    Portugal, Madeira

    The wine shows brown colour
    In the nose, the wine shows dried citrus notes, oxidation notes, VA notes, varnish, underlying sweetness, stone fruit notes, raisin notes.
    Palate follows the pattern, warmth, dried stone fruit, high acidity, nutty, almond, espresso coffee notes, toffee notes, med to full body, long finish
    Called this Malmsey
